    Abstract

    The RV Kronprins Haakon cruise Nansen Legacy seasonal Q4 (Q4= 4th quarter of the year) contributed to the seasonal investigation of the northern Barents Sea and adjacent Arctic Basin. This activity is a key milestone for 2019. The cruise addressed objectives of the research foci in RF1 on Physical drivers, RF2 on Human drivers and RF3 on the living Barents Sea, and collected necessary data along the Nansen Legacy transect in open waters and within the ice cover. Experiments were an important component of the research to quantify processes, rates and interactions that will also feed modeling work and projections in RF4. The ongoing establishment of routines for sampling, data management and data storing continued as part of the practical work onboard.
